Nestled in the heart of Oxfordshire, Oxford Parkway Train Station is an essential hub for both local commuters and tourists. Opened in 2015, it's a relatively new addition to the UK's vast rail network, strategically positioned to cater to those travelling to and from the historic city of Oxford and beyond. Whether you're on your way to catch a game at Wembley Stadium or heading for a cultural excursion to London, Oxford Parkway offers numerous convenient travel options.
Oxford Parkway is well-equipped to ensure a smooth and comfortable journey for all travellers. The station features a comprehensive ticket office that operates from early morning until late at night. If you've bought your tickets online, you can conveniently collect them from the ticket machines available on-site. Accessibility is a top priority with step-free access to all platforms and dedicated ticket machines equipped for those with accessibility needs.
The station’s amenities include accessible toilets as well as baby changing facilities, ensuring a family-friendly atmosphere. Meanwhile, those needing assistance can find staff available from early morning till the close of service to help with enquiries or assistive needs.
While luggage storage is not available, Oxford Parkway maintains a secure environment with CCTV coverage throughout the premises. Refreshment seekers can enjoy a variety of options with a cozy coffee shop ready to serve your caffeine needs, though shopping facilities are not provided.
Cycling to and from the station is a breeze with abundant bicycle storage space located conveniently on the station forecourt. CCTV protection is in place to ensure your bike’s safety, offering peace of mind as you travel. However, those looking for bike rental services will need to explore options outside the station, as no cycle hire facilities are currently available.
Beyond its excellent rail services, Oxford Parkway offers strong connections with local transport systems. For instance, rail replacement services and local buses are easily accessible from the station front or the nearby Park & Ride stop. Planning your onward travel is straightforward, with useful resources available to print online.
While directly available taxis aren't accessible for those requiring specific accommodations, there's ample parking, including 18 accessible spaces, located in the station’s 24-hour car park.

Stepping into Caledonian Road & Barnsbury station, you're greeted by the unassuming charm of a station that has served the London borough of Islington with great efficiency. Nestled in a busy neighborhood, the station operates predominantly as part of the London Overground network, making it an essential link in the capital's extensive rail system.
The station offers basic yet functional facilities to accommodate its passengers. While the ticket office is open from Monday to Friday between 07:30 and 10:00, ticket machines are available for those purchasing or collecting tickets at more flexible hours. Access for wheelchair users is made easier with accessible ticket machines and step-free access on parts of the station.
Although there aren't any shops, refreshment facilities, ATMs, or even toilets on site, customer help points ensure passenger services are still available. The presence of CCTV enhances security, offering peace of mind to travelers who might be leaving their bicycles at the available 9 bike stands. Although there's no wheelchair-accessible taxi service directly available, passengers are encouraged to book assistance in advance or use the "Turn-up-and-go" service provided by the London Overground.
Getting around from Caledonian Road & Barnsbury is straightforward, albeit with some minor planning involved. There are no direct rail replacement services from the station itself. For rail replacement services heading east towards Stratford, or west towards Gospel Oak/Hampstead Heath, take a bus from the stops at Highbury & Islington station nearby. If you are looking to explore more of London, the Caledonian Road underground station is only a short 10-minute walk away, giving you access to the bustling Piccadilly Line.
